Now with October looming, the next wave of free games for PlayStation Plus is upon us. From its PlayStation State of Play, we now learned the roster for Halloween season is complementing the approaching holiday. Next month players will be met with Alan Wake II, Goat Simulator 3, and Cocoon in October.
Not only that, but some teases for PlayStation Plus Game Catalog was also revealed as well. Come September 26th is ‘The Last of Us Day’ and to celebrate, 2020’s The Last of Us Part II will be added to the service. Even more, select retro titles are on the way too. Sony Interactive Entertainment confirmed Tekken 3 & Soulcalibur 3 are both being added as well.

Alan Wake II, Goat Simulator 3, and Cocoon arrive to PlayStation Plus on October 7, 2025.
